Go To The Can In An Igloo Above Garmisch
26th October 2007 | By Patrick Thorne
Resorts in this article: Garmisch Classic - Garmisch-Partenkirchen
The Swiss Iglu-Village company will offer a high-spec 'Romantic Igloo Plus' at its base on the Zugspitze Mountain above Garmisch this winter. This igloo for overnight stays offers the extra comfort of a private lavatory.
The German village is the largest of five Igloo Villages offering by the highly successful business. Other options are the established villages at Zermatt on the Gornergrat with a view of the majestic Matterhorn; Engelberg by Lake Trübsee; Gstaad in the Rüeblihorn area and new this year, Davos.
